Output efded3833a4b680ffd92e9dd7dadfe60be2952a35208df5e3a98b6716fa3f8dc:0

value
2033144
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f11a8e77ba03562025643e1cd3bedac1c66aedc OP_EQUAL
address
3EjVhzsorTt2H9XBGNdaPcYMF68p24Bx7L
transaction
efded3833a4b680ffd92e9dd7dadfe60be2952a35208df5e3a98b6716fa3f8dc
confirmations
170258
spent
true